The approach to Kor's Door from the foot of Lambs Slide. Photo taken 8/1/04. We stashed our extra gear here, and continued on carrying just what we were taking up the climb.

From here, it took us about 45 minutes to reach the start of the climb.

An ice axe was helpful, but not essential, for the initial snow section. My partner crossed the snow in his rock shoes, kicking toeholds, with no ice axe. I had rock shoes on as well, and was glad I had an ice axe. Next time, I'll wear my approach shoes!
